ENGLISH DESCRIPTION CLAR?N NOVEL PRIZE“A contemporary and mysterious novel, in the tradition of the weird, with references to Arthur Machen, Lovecraft, and Chambers–featuring a touch of ecological horror and remarkable historical reconstruction.” — Mariana Enriquez There is something alive and unclassifiable that has coursed through planet Earth since its creation–and seems capable of outliving it. It spreads beneath the surface and emerges like a fantastic plant, in every sense of the word. Its existence is recounted by the novel’s different narrators–voices that speak from 1504, 1888, and 1945–and through the temporal arc of a future that only literature can imagine. Time and again, as humanity grows and reflects upon itself, the biont–this organism that both terrifies and shelters–becomes a mirror of historical evolution, shadowed by the horror of its own idea of progress.
